1. A method for supplementing electronic position data, the method comprising:

  • collecting electronic position data on a portable electronic device during a fitness activity, the portable electronic device comprising a microprocessor, a memory, a microphone, a display screen, a user input, a satellite positioning system receiver, a digital camera, and a wireless communication transceiver, the electronic position data being determined via the satellite positioning system receiver;

    inputting supplemental electronic data into the portable electronic device and electronically linking the supplemental electronic data to the electronic position data,wherein the supplemental electronic data comprises one of a voice annotation, a digital image, a digital video segment, and electronic text;

    storing the electronically linked electronic position data and the supplemental electronic data in the memory of the portable electronic device;

    wirelessly transmitting the electronically linked electronic position data and the supplemental electronic data to a remote computer via the wireless communication transceiver;

    receiving the electronically linked electronic position data and the supplemental electronic data on a second portable electronic device, the second portable electronic device comprising a display screen, a microprocessor, a memory, a microphone, a user input, a satellite positioning system receiver, a digital camera, and a wireless communication transceiver; and

    displaying the electronic position data and the supplemental electronic data on the display screen of the second portable electronic device.
